Warning Signs You Need Aquarium Leak Water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Catch them early and save yourself a headache.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your home can be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t ignore them, it’s a sign of a bigger problem.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Visible water stains or discoloration on your ceiling or walls are a clear indication of a leak. Don’t delay in addressing the issue.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age from an aquarium leak. Inspect your floors carefully to pr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Listen for unusual sounds or leaks from your aquarium, such as dripping or gurgling noises. They can be a sign of a bigger issue.

Visible Leaks or Water Spots

Visible leaks or water spots on your aquarium or surrounding surfaces are a clear indication of a problem. Address it before it’s too late.
